Boy Scout - Star Seminar Attendance Procedure

AS IN SOME OTHER COUNCILS, THE TALL PINE COUNCIL DISTRIBUTES MATERIALS FROM BSA HEADQUARTERS NECESSARY FOR THE SCOUT'S WORK ON THE EAGLE RANK AT OUR STAR SEMINARS. WE PROVIDE THE OPPORTUNITY FOR SCOUTS, PARENTS, AND A REPRESENTATIVE FROM THE TROOP TO ASK QUESTIONS, THUS ASSURING THEY HAVE CURRENT INFORMATION. ATTENDANCE AT ONE OF THESE SEMINARS IS VERY IMPORTANT BECAUSE REQUIREMENTS FOR THE EAGLE RANK CHANGE.

THE FOLLOWING PROCEDURE WILL BE USED TO ATTEND THE STAR SEMINARS.

SCOUT:
1. The Scout earns the rank of Star Scout.

COUNCIL OFFICE:
1. The Council Office mails every Scout who earns the rank of Star Scout a congratulatory letter with information about the Star Seminar.

SCOUT:
1. The Scout notes the months Star Seminars are held and discusses with his parents the seminar they wish to attend.

2. The Scout calls the Council Office and registers for the Star Seminar he wishes to attend. He notes the place and time of the seminar.

COUNCIL OFFICE:
1. The Council Office maintains a list of all Scouts who register.

2. The Council Office prepares a Star Seminar Packet for each registered Scout. Parents and a Troop representatives will not receive a packet.

DISTRICT ADVANCEMENT CHAIRMAN:
1: The District Advancement Chairman, makes arrangements for the seminar, notifies the Council Office well in advance of the date, time, and place of the seminar, and picks up the packets for the Scouts.

2. Provides a sheet at each seminar for Scouts to sign-in. The forms are returned and filed in the Council Office; a copy is sent to each District Advancement Chairman.

3. The instructor gives each Scout attending a "proof of attendance" form.

4. The instructor ensures that all the materials to be handed out are current and present.

SCOUT:
1. The Scout ensures that he receives all the information handed out at the seminar.

2. The Scout is responsible for all the materials distributed at the seminar. These are the only copies he will receive.

3. The Scout signs the attendance sheet.
